Transaction ecad5107e253b68dccdebf28d2106bb7a7d7acc407e17d9e421332f71128470b
2 Input
2 Outputs
- ecad5107e253b68dccdebf28d2106bb7a7d7acc407e17d9e421332f71128470b:0
- ecad5107e253b68dccdebf28d2106bb7a7d7acc407e17d9e421332f71128470b:1
value 78058
address 171cURxn8ZAK5BZRCUmFRcyK7Qdpsz6r3M
value 636499
address 3CSJUdrkcxkvdUfRfmgxGFNiWcTKctUki4